Saria is a member of the Kokiri who live in Kokiri Forest under their guardian, the Great Deku Tree in Ocarina of Time. She is Link's best friend and helps him throughout his quest. Being a Kokiri she never grows older, and remains a child throughout her life.

When Link leaves the Forest, Saria is waiting for him. Obviously distraught to learn of Links departure, she gives him the Fairy Ocarina as a memento and a reminder of their friendship.

When Link returns to the forest after visiting Princess Zelda, he finds Saria deep in the Lost Woods in the Sacred Forest Meadow, Saria teaches Link "Saria's Song", a melody that allows Link to communicate with Saria at any time.

When Ganondorf obtains the Triforce of Power and takes control of Hyrule, Link learns by talking to the Kokiri that Saria sensed something wrong happened to the forest temple, so she went there to check and saw the place was crawling with monsters.

Link then goes to the Forest Temple and ends up awakening Saria as the Sage of Forest, revealed after Link defeats Phantom Ganon at the end of the Forest Temple.

It is implied that Saria actually have deeper feelings for Link, since when she's awakened as a Sage, she talks about how they can't be together because she has to stay in the Sacred Realm. A clearer sign of that is an incomplete sentence Mido says after Link completes the forest temple: "But...I...I made a promise to Saria... If Link came back, I would be sure to tell him that Saria had been waiting for him... Because Saria...really... liked".

Saria assists the other Sages in sealing Ganondorf away in the Sacred Realm at the end of the game.

Trivia

  • After Link obtains the Ocarina of Time, if he plays Saria's Song and talks to Saria she will say that his ocarina sounds different and asks if he had been practicing much.
